Keith E Poling 1931 - 2009

Keith E Poling of Homosassa, Citrus County, FL was born on January 16, 1931, and died at age 78 years old on September 17, 2009. Keith Poling was buried at Florida National Cemetery Section 606 Site 1037 6502 Sw. 102nd Ave., in Bushnell.

In 1931, in the year that Keith E Poling was born, in March, “The Star Spangled Banner” officially became the national anthem by congressional resolution. Other songs had previously been used - among them, "My Country, 'Tis of Thee", "God Bless America", and "America the Beautiful". There was fierce debate about making "The Star Spangled Banner" the national anthem - Southerners and veterans organizations supported it, pacifists and educators opposed it.
